What's interesting about Universal in Orlando, is that two parks combined have less capacity than any one of the Disney parks yet they are doing comparable attendance numbers to 3 of their parks if you believe TEA. It's quite striking - Islands of Adventure has 29K capacity and Studios 27K. Disney on the other hand Animal Kingdom and their Studios are 60K a piece, and Epcot is 110K and Magic Kingdom 100K.
